Is California redwood a sustainable product?

Redwood grows best alongside the Pacific coast of the United States, from California up via southern Oregon. Mendocino Forest Products and its sister corporate, Humboldt Redwood, are the most important producers and distributers of redwood merchandise. The 440,000 acres of forestland which we personal are all sustainably controlled for the manufacturing of redwood and Douglas fir lumber and licensed by way of the FSC (Forest Stewardship Council).

Most other folks bring to mind California redwood as large, old-growth bushes, but it surely’s been over a decade since we harvested the ones. All the old-growth redwood forests are actually preserved as federal parklands. What we arrange is second-growth forests of more youthful bushes and we in reality develop extra trees once a year than we harvest. In addition to the trees manufacturing, we additionally maintain all different forest-related attributes comparable to soil high quality, water high quality, and flora and fauna.

What are some benefits of creating with redwood?

Redwood is outstanding for its herbal sturdiness. You can use it for any outside carpentry undertaking the place it’s absolutely uncovered to climate, like a lawn shed or a pergola, in addition to external decking and fencing. It doesn’t should be chemically handled because it’s naturally proof against decay and bugs. Contrast this with non-durable wooden species, whose lifespan is just a handful of years in the event you don’t practice a preservative, while redwood can closing 2 or Three many years.

Redwood may be gorgeous – an overly sexy colour and grain construction. Its somewhat mild weight, mixed with power and balance, make it simple to paintings with.  Whether you’re slicing, sawing, putting screws, or acting every other roughly machining process, redwood handles well. Due to its open grain construction, redwood will hang a end higher than maximum different woods, for progressed look and sturdiness through the years. If left unfinished, it is going to ultimately flip driftwood grey, however it is going to nonetheless hang up really well.

How a lot upkeep does redwood require?

Redwood outdoor will probably be uncovered to mud, leaves, pollen, chicken droppings, most likely grease out of your fish fry, and so forth. Clean the wooden sometimes with water, including an eco-friendly product like Simple Green if it is extremely dirty. Usually cleansing a couple of times a 12 months and refinishing with stain or paint each and every 2-Three years is perfect for one thing like a porch or gazebo. A picnic desk will have to be wiped clean and oiled once a year, sooner than the outside entertaining season starts.

How does redwood evaluate to different hardscape development fabrics?

Cedar, regularly used for outside initiatives, isn’t a US-grown product like California redwood, because it incessantly comes from Canada. It’s additionally incessantly harvested from old-growth forests.

Tropical hardwoods from Central and South America, or Indonesia could also be advertised as sustainably forested and harvested, however there may be numerous skepticism round those claims .

Although Southern yellow pine is a pleasant species, most commonly sustainably grown, it does wish to be chemically power handled, elevating well being issues, particularly in the event you put it to use for container gardening of greens. (Redwood, however, can be utilized for planter packing containers and not using a worries).

Other merchandise like plastics or plastic composites might declare to have some recycled content material; alternatively, most of the higher-performance plastic merchandise don’t incorporate a lot recycled subject material. They’re additionally slightly dear, heavy, and tough to paintings with. In , strolling on a plastic deck may also be very popular and unsightly underfoot.
